Food and Beverage Assistant
2 weeks ago
Following a two year refurbishment programme the Thames Riviera Hotel is ready to open. The opportunity to join a vibrant enthusiastic team has arisen.
We are looking to recruit friendly people with great personalities, the rest can be trained.
Main duties and responsibilities include:
- To clean designated areas, in accordance with laid-down procedures, morning/evening routines and hygiene requirements.
- To clean and refill cruet and condiment sets, order sauces and chutneys to ensure consistent supply.
- To set tables to laid-down standards, ensuring that all items used are clean, undamaged and in a good state of repair.
- To ensure stations are adequately stocked with replacement cutlery, linen or other established needs, be they food or equipment.
- To take orders from customers and ensure these are given to the appropriate person to execute.
- To be totally familiar with the composition of all menu items.
- To serve food and beverages in accordance with laid-down standards, but above all in a professional, courteous manner.
- To clean tables and ensure they are cleaned as soon as it is apparent that customers have finished their food or drink with an acceptable balance between speed, yet allowing customers to finish their meal without feeling rushed.
- To ensure that customers are correctly charged, present the bill and take payment from the customer, in accordance with the procedures of the hotel.
- At all times to be aware of and practice good customer relations, assisting the guest in any way which does not adversely affect other customers.
- To report any suspicious packages or parcels to management without delay.
- To take part in any fire evacuation drills and ensure completed familiarization with all exits, including those normally used by customers, as well as fire escapes.
- To be continually aware of, and maintain the highest standards of personal hygiene and dress.
- To attend meetings and training courses as required
**Ideal you will have**:
- Previous experience within the hospitality industry.
- Good communications skills with basic English written and spoken level.
- Ability to work and multi-task in a fast-paced environment.
Punctual and reliable with a positive can-do attitude.
